:root{--cl-safe-green:#12ff80;--cl-safe-white:#fff;--cl-safe-black:#121312;--cl-accent-9:#f76d18;--cl-accent-10:#ff801f;--cl-border:#4b4b4b;--cl-border-light:grey;--cl-border-hover:#b7b7b7;--cl-overlay:rgba(75,85,99,.25);--cl-modal-bg:hsla(0,0%,5%,.92);--cl-panel-bg:rgba(18,19,18,.9);--cl-text-muted:#c8c8c8;--cl-error:#ff6b6b;--cl-font:"Manrope","Space Grotesk",-apple-system,BlinkMacSystemFont,sans-serif;--cl-radius:12px;--cl-gap:1.25rem;--cl-input-bg:rgba(0,0,0,.1);--cl-select-bg:rgba(0,0,0,.8);--cl-overlay-hover:rgba(0,0,0,.1);--cl-shadow-overlay:rgba(0,0,0,.1)}.text-safe_white{color:var(--cl-safe-white)}.hover\:text-safe_green:hover,.text-safe_green{color:var(--cl-safe-green)}.hover\:text-safe_white:hover{color:var(--cl-safe-white)}.hover\:bg-safe_green:hover{background-color:var(--cl-safe-green)}.focus\:ring-safe_green:focus{box-shadow:0 0 0 2px rgba(18,255,128,.4);outline:none}.bg-accent-9{background-color:var(--cl-accent-9)}.hover\:bg-accent-10:hover{background-color:var(--cl-accent-10)}.cl-hover-text-green:hover,.cl-text-green{color:#12ff80}.cl-hover-bg-green:hover{background-color:#12ff80}.cl-focus-ring-green:focus{box-shadow:0 0 0 2px rgba(18,255,128,.2);outline:none}.cl-bg-accent{background-color:#f76d18}.cl-hover-bg-accent:hover{background-color:#ff801f}.cl-border-gray{border-color:grey}.cl-placeholder-gray::placeholder{color:#868686}.cl-bg-input{background-color:var(--cl-input-bg)}.cl-bg-select{background-color:var(--cl-select-bg)}.cl-hover-bg-overlay:hover{background-color:var(--cl-overlay-hover)}.cl-focus-shadow:focus{box-shadow:0 0 0 2px var(--cl-shadow-overlay)}.cl-contact-link{width:36px;height:36px;border-radius:8px;background-color:hsla(0,0%,100%,.1);color:var(--cl-safe-white);display:inline-flex;align-items:center;justify-content:center;transition:background-color .2s ease,color .2s ease}.cl-contact-link:hover{background-color:var(--cl-safe-green);color:#000}.cl-trigger-button{padding:10px 24px;border-radius:6px;border:1px solid var(--cl-safe-green);background:transparent;color:var(--cl-safe-green);font-size:14px;font-weight:600;letter-spacing:.04em;text-transform:uppercase;cursor:pointer;transition:background-color .2s ease,color .2s ease}.cl-trigger-button:hover{background-color:var(--cl-safe-green);color:#000}.cl-contact-form{width:100%;display:flex;flex-direction:column;gap:20px;margin-top:8px}.cl-field{flex:1;display:flex;flex-direction:column;gap:8px}.cl-label{font-size:14px;color:var(--cl-safe-white)}.cl-input,.cl-select-trigger,.cl-textarea{width:100%;border-radius:10px;border:1px solid var(--cl-border-light);background-color:var(--cl-input-bg);color:var(--cl-safe-white);font-size:16px;padding:14px 18px;transition:border-color .2s ease,box-shadow .2s ease}.cl-input:focus,.cl-select-trigger:focus,.cl-textarea:focus{outline:none;border-color:var(--cl-border-hover);box-shadow:0 0 0 2px rgba(18,255,128,.2)}.cl-input-error{border-color:var(--cl-error)}.cl-textarea{min-height:140px;resize:vertical}.cl-select-trigger{display:flex;align-items:center;justify-content:space-between;text-align:left}.cl-select-icon{margin-left:12px}.cl-select-content{min-width:240px;background-color:hsla(0,0%,6%,.95);border:1px solid var(--cl-border);border-radius:10px;box-shadow:0 20px 45px rgba(0,0,0,.5);color:var(--cl-safe-white)}.cl-select-viewport{padding:6px}.cl-select-item{padding:10px 12px;border-radius:8px;display:flex;align-items:center;justify-content:space-between;cursor:pointer;font-size:15px}.cl-select-item:hover,.cl-select-item[data-highlighted=true]{background-color:var(--cl-safe-green);color:#000}.cl-select-indicator{font-size:14px}.cl-checkbox-row{display:flex;align-items:flex-start;gap:12px}.cl-checkbox{width:18px;height:18px;margin-top:4px}.cl-checkbox-label{font-size:14px;line-height:1.5;color:var(--cl-safe-white)}.cl-policy-link{color:var(--cl-safe-green);text-decoration:underline;cursor:pointer;background:none;border:none;padding:0;font:inherit}.cl-error{font-size:13px;color:var(--cl-error)}.cl-submit-button{align-self:center;width:160px;height:56px;border-radius:16px;border:none;background:linear-gradient(90deg,var(--cl-accent-9),var(--cl-accent-10));color:#000;font-size:16px;font-weight:600;text-transform:uppercase;cursor:pointer;transition:transform .2s ease,opacity .2s ease}.cl-submit-button:disabled{opacity:.7;cursor:not-allowed}.cl-submit-button:not(:disabled):hover{transform:translateY(-2px)}.cl-legal-dialog{width:min(900px,calc(100vw - 32px))}.cl-legal-scroll{max-height:85vh;overflow-y:auto;padding-right:8px}.section-privacy-policy{color:var(--cl-safe-white);font-size:14px}.section-privacy-policy p{margin:15px 0}.section-privacy-policy li{margin:10px 0 10px 25px}.section-privacy-policy h1,.section-privacy-policy h2,.section-privacy-policy h3{margin:20px 0 10px;font-weight:600}.section-privacy-policy .dotList li:before,.section-privacy-policy .dotList2 p:before{content:"•";color:#507bef;font-weight:700;display:inline-block;width:1em;margin-left:-1em}@keyframes modalIn{0%{opacity:0;transform:translate(-50%,-50%) scale(0)}to{opacity:1;transform:translate(-50%,-50%) scale(1)}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es fadeOut{0%{opacity:1}to{opacity:0}}@keyframes modalOut{0%{opacity:1;transform:translate(-50%,-50%) scale(1)}to{opacity:0;transform:translate(-50%,-50%) scale(0)}}.animate-fadeIn{animation:fadeIn .2s ease forwards}.animate-fadeOut{animation:fadeOut .2s ease forwards}.animate-modalIn{animation:modalIn .5s cubic-bezier(.87,0,.13,1) forwards}.animate-modalOut{animation:modalOut .5s cubic-bezier(.87,0,.13,1) forwards}[data-state=open][class*=animate-fadeIn]{animation:fadeIn .2s ease forwards}[data-state=closed][class*=animate-fadeOut]{animation:fadeOut .2s ease forwards}[data-state=open][class*=animate-modalIn]{animation:modalIn .5s cubic-bezier(.87,0,.13,1) forwards}[data-state=closed][class*=animate-modalOut]{animation:modalOut .5s cubic-bezier(.87,0,.13,1) forwards}@font-face{font-family:__inter_1361c6;src:url(/_next/static/media/cc27cf3ff100ea21-s.p.ttf) format("truetype");font-display:swap}@font-face{font-family:__inter_Fallback_1361c6;src:local("Arial");ascent-override:89.79%;descent-override:22.36%;line-gap-override:0.00%;size-adjust:107.89%}.__className_1361c6{font-family:__inter_1361c6,__inter_Fallback_1361c6}.__variable_1361c6{--font-body:"__inter_1361c6","__inter_Fallback_1361c6"}@font-face{font-family:__ibmPlexMono_3bf016;src:url(/_next/static/media/b01b725c4365f934-s.p.ttf) format("truetype");font-display:swap;font-weight:400}@font-face{font-family:__ibmPlexMono_Fallback_3bf016;src:local("Arial");ascent-override:102.50%;descent-override:27.50%;line-gap-override:0.00%;size-adjust:100.00%}.__className_3bf016{font-family:__ibmPlexMono_3bf016,__ibmPlexMono_Fallback_3bf016;font-weight:400}.__variable_3bf016{--font-mono:"__ibmPlexMono_3bf016","__ibmPlexMono_Fallback_3bf016"}@font-face{font-family:__ibmPlexSans_d92a8b;src:url(/_next/static/media/c7dc84d05cfe8080-s.p.ttf) format("truetype");font-display:swap;font-weight:400}@font-face{font-family:__ibmPlexSans_d92a8b;src:url(/_next/static/media/b57725b8c3470143-s.p.ttf) format("truetype");font-display:swap;font-weight:500}@font-face{font-family:__ibmPlexSans_d92a8b;src:url(/_next/static/media/efb590a61a6e0af3-s.p.ttf) format("truetype");font-display:swap;font-weight:700}@font-face{font-family:__ibmPlexSans_Fallback_d92a8b;src:local("Arial");ascent-override:101.35%;descent-override:27.19%;line-gap-override:0.00%;size-adjust:101.13%}.__className_d92a8b{font-family:__ibmPlexSans_d92a8b,__ibmPlexSans_Fallback_d92a8b}.__variable_d92a8b{--font-heading:"__ibmPlexSans_d92a8b","__ibmPlexSans_Fallback_d92a8b"}@font-face{font-family:__leagueSpartan_796b0b;src:url(/_next/static/media/596e3b529fdf0365-s.p.ttf) format("truetype");font-display:swap;font-weight:400}@font-face{font-family:__leagueSpartan_796b0b;src:url(/_next/static/media/724cd4f9b6227c62-s.p.ttf) format("truetype");font-display:swap;font-weight:700}@font-face{font-family:__leagueSpartan_Fallback_796b0b;src:local("Arial");ascent-override:75.22%;descent-override:23.64%;line-gap-override:0.00%;size-adjust:93.06%}.__className_796b0b{font-family:__leagueSpartan_796b0b,__leagueSpartan_Fallback_796b0b}.__variable_796b0b{--font-spartan:"__leagueSpartan_796b0b","__leagueSpartan_Fallback_796b0b"}@font-face{font-family:__manrope_9df436;src:url(/_next/static/media/67eeae0d3c990763-s.p.ttf) format("truetype");font-display:swap;font-weight:200}@font-face{font-family:__manrope_9df436;src:url(/_next/static/media/a3ecbf6d7baa059d-s.p.ttf) format("truetype");font-display:swap;font-weight:300}@font-face{font-family:__manrope_9df436;src:url(/_next/static/media/defbff1c3961a844-s.p.ttf) format("truetype");font-display:swap;font-weight:400}@font-face{font-family:__manrope_9df436;src:url(/_next/static/media/dd201342dd842375-s.p.ttf) format("truetype");font-display:swap;font-weight:500}@font-face{font-family:__manrope_9df436;src:url(/_next/static/media/250ef9cac77222cc-s.p.ttf) format("truetype");font-display:swap;font-weight:600}@font-face{font-family:__manrope_9df436;src:url(/_next/static/media/7fd73fa81853a7bc-s.p.ttf) format("truetype");font-display:swap;font-weight:700}@font-face{font-family:__manrope_9df436;src:url(/_next/static/media/dcfe367e16e16eea-s.p.ttf) format("truetype");font-display:swap;font-weight:800}@font-face{font-family:__manrope_Fallback_9df436;src:local("Arial");ascent-override:102.74%;descent-override:28.91%;line-gap-override:0.00%;size-adjust:103.76%}.__className_9df436{font-family:__manrope_9df436,__manrope_Fallback_9df436}.__variable_9df436{--font-display:"__manrope_9df436","__manrope_Fallback_9df436"}